-----If infact it is the camber kit----

I hear ya. Had the same problem. I've had problems with my Ingalls Kit.

The bottoming out of the upper-arm must have damaged the bushing housing (metal sleave).

If you have the rubber bushing kits DO NOT GREASE IT!!! The rubber is supposed to stick in the bushing housing. Adding any grease (including silicon grease) will make it worst (the grease will allow side to side movement screwing up you alignment, in fact you will never get it aligned correctly if this happens). I sent my kits back to Ingalls twice (all four fronts, once and 1 a second time). Heres the problem... The kits must be installed correctly the first time they are installed. Squeeking and creaking is the metal bushing housing breaking loose and rotating each time your suspension moves... so take them out and inspect them... if you find that any part is rotating (nothing should be rotating on the rubber bushing kit) call and speak to Todd Buman at Ingalls... Tell him what your situation is and he may ask you to send them in for warranty repair (don't worry about the 90 warranty period stated on the web-site, I had mine over a year and he fixed them for me). Just be nice.

Now that you have your fenders cut correctly for the clearance, when you get them back make sure you tighten all bolt and nuts with the suspension loaded (wheel off, axle jacked up). And remember NO GREASE ON THE RUBBER BUSHING KIT!!!

Originally posted by HyDrOpOnIkToKa
can we spray WD-40 on rubber bushings to decrease noise?
No, I wouldn't recommend it. If you have noise, something is wrong with the camber kit (Ingalls). Others were telling me to use silicon grease because silicon grease will not eat rubber.
I was misled by others in suggesting this remedy, but fix was very short term.

To answer your question directly, WD-40 is petrolum based... I believe it will eat the rubber, causing more or other problems.

To solve the problem you need to replace the kit or send it in for repair.
